Output 415680764cdcc8b4c105a40345dcc67ccfe71db126928463b9c466bcfe8580d2:30

value
96654
script pubkey
OP_0 OP_PUSHBYTES_32 2b582685e08e703e7efea6bfe7043a76df70055699923815287aba4b69da6ce5
address
bc1q9dvzdp0q3ecrulh756l7wpp6wm0hqp2knxfrs9fg02ayk6w6dnjsxk00e3
transaction
415680764cdcc8b4c105a40345dcc67ccfe71db126928463b9c466bcfe8580d2
confirmations
11634
spent
true